@paco , a 67 inch ski @ 200 lbs and 6 ft seems way short at 32 IMO. For reference I am 5'9 , 165 ish and just purchased a 65.5 HO A2 and I called them before I purchased as reference chart suggested my weight should call for 66.5, they said for 36mph 65.5 is correct . I would be more inclined to believe based on what you are saying , the A2 just needs to be setup properly with the fin/binding. Call HO they will point you in the right direction. I just knew that people would be preaching JB weld on this one , the fact remains that product is UNREAL for fixing all kinds of stuff. Good luck and please post a pic AFTER the repair. I have like someone else posted used marine epoxy with great success on a ski's sidewall , sanded it down and then a little touch up paint , you could not tell and that ski is still going strong 10 seasons later!
